Mazda MX-5 Miata — Track Day (cold) Tire Pressure
For track day (cold) use on the Mazda MX-5 Miata, set cold pressures to 25 PSI front and 25 PSI rear.
Track Day (cold) cold pressure
Front
25
172 kPa
-4 vs OEM
Rear
25
172 kPa
-4 vs OEM
OEM spec
29/29 PSI
Tire size
195/50R16
Curb weight
1,065 kg
Category
sports
Tires gain 4–6 PSI when hot on track. Start 4 PSI below street to land near the ideal 36–38 PSI hot window.
Community-tuned pressures based on OEM spec + typical use-case deltas. Always verify against your door-jamb sticker for your exact trim and load rating. Minimum safe pressure is 24 PSI for most passenger tires.

Frequently asked
- What tire pressure should I use for track driving in the Mazda MX-5 Miata?
- For track day (cold) use on the Mazda MX-5 Miata, set cold pressures to 25 PSI front and 25 PSI rear. Tires gain 4–6 PSI when hot on track. Start 4 PSI below street to land near the ideal 36–38 PSI hot window.
- What is the OEM tire pressure for the Mazda MX-5 Miata?
- The factory cold pressure spec for the 2016–2024 Mazda MX-5 Miata is 29 PSI front / 29 PSI rear. Always use the door-jamb sticker for your specific trim.
- Why drop the pressure for track use?
- Track tires gain 4–6 PSI of pressure when hot. Starting 4 PSI low (at 25/25 cold) should land you near the ideal 36–38 PSI hot window, where you get the best grip and most even tire wear.
